Transaction 245d6290934892d2aece80e3d2ddf24e1fd2d8ef12c3e09c7d3f09d162b2a37e
1 Input
2 Outputs
- 245d6290934892d2aece80e3d2ddf24e1fd2d8ef12c3e09c7d3f09d162b2a37e:0
- 245d6290934892d2aece80e3d2ddf24e1fd2d8ef12c3e09c7d3f09d162b2a37e:1
value 610
address 17ph4hbe7zo25LLW8RDEb7Cp6DhnpDAmaS
value 1835589
address 3Np6F18Ap1yix9nFEzeePpNKetSDgkkZHT